Government is delaying elections to sideline BNP: Dudu

 VB  Desk

VB Desk

BNP Vice-Chairman Shamsuzzaman Dudu has alleged that the interim government is delaying the elections to sideline his party.

He made this allegation at a rally organized by the Bangladesh Gonotantrik Parishad in front of the National Press Club on Friday (April 18).

The rally was organized demanding the trace of missing leaders and activists including BNP leaders Ilias Ali and Chowdhury Alam.

Shamsuzzaman Dudu said that the elections are being avoided so that BNP cannot form a government through elections, by garnering people's support, and through votes.

Expressing concern over the activities of the interim government, Dudu said that the countrymen are very worried about the activities of this government. "We do not even understand what they (the government) want."

Criticizing the government's role in the election issue, he said: "What to do or not to do is not a big deal." He announced a road map immediately to establish an elected government. "Tell me when the elections will be held, in which month, in which year. You can exclude these once in December, once in June. We are not ready for these."

This BNP leader warned the authorities and said: "I have told you before, when we have managed to oust Hasina, if other fascisms arise, it will be a one-two matter for the people of Bangladesh to oust them. Keeping that in mind, we will take action. I received you with a garland of flowers, I want to bid you farewell with a garland of flowers—this is the BNP's stand so far."

Demanding immediate visible trial of the disappearances, he said: "The disappearances of Ilyas Ali, Chowdhury Alam and others… how tragic… I cannot pray for the forgiveness of their souls, since we do not know whether Ilyas Ali, Chowdhury Alam is dead or still alive. What will their families pray to Allah, what will their heirs demand?"

The BNP Vice-Chairman said: "The people of Bangladesh know that those who created this deadlock, Sheikh Hasina, did not just disappear him (Ilias Ali), she did not kidnap him, she wanted to eliminate him. I am demanding in this meeting that thousands of national leaders, student leaders, youth leaders including Ilias Ali, Chowdhury Alam - whom we have not yet found, I demand the hanging of Hasina for this crime. Take the initiative to prosecute the disappearances and murders."
